Digital Safety in the Age of Adult Content

As alluring as adult content may be, users need to navigate the digital landscape responsibly to avoid risks associated with malware, phishing, or identity theft.

1. Use Secure Connections

Adult websites are often targets for cybercriminals. Always ensure that you are accessing sites over secure connections (look for "HTTPS" in the URL). This minimizes the risk of data breaches.

2. Protect Your Privacy

  • Consider using a VPN: A Virtual Private Network can help mask your IP address, protecting your identity and browsing history from potential spying or data harvesting.
  • Be mindful of personal details: When engaging with adult sites or forums, avoid sharing any identifying information—be it photographs or sensitive data.

3. Recognize Scams and Malware

Adult sites can also serve as gateways for malware. Beware of pop-ups offering "exclusive content" or "special memberships." Always have up-to-date antivirus software to detect and neutralize threats.
